Backroom Music is a deep, soulful house album that embraces intimacy, mood, and musical storytelling. TribeSoul crafts a project rooted in underground house culture, focusing on rich instrumentation, emotional depth, and immersive groove structures rather than commercial dancefloor intensity.

The album is characterized by warm basslines, layered percussion, jazzy chords, and atmospheric synth textures that create a smooth, late-night listening experience. TribeSoul’s production style leans toward subtle progression, allowing tracks to evolve gradually while maintaining a hypnotic and calming rhythm.

Vocals and instrumental elements throughout the album are carefully balanced, often leaning toward soulful expression and spiritual undertones. The project captures the feeling of private groove sessions and intimate club spaces, where music is felt deeply rather than simply heard.

Thematically, Backroom Music explores emotion, connection, and musical freedom, reflecting the essence of underground house culture. Each track contributes to a cohesive sonic journey, maintaining consistency while offering enough variation to keep the album engaging from start to finish.

Overall, Backroom Music is a refined and atmospheric deep house project — soulful, immersive, and emotionally rich — showcasing TribeSoul’s dedication to authentic, mood-driven house music.
